Rahul Gandhi, the Leader of the Opposition in India, met with leaders of various farm unions on February 13, 2026, to discuss a nationwide movement against the IndiaUnited States interim trade deal. The farm union leaders expressed deep concern that the deal would open the door for agricultural imports, threatening the livelihoods of farmers cultivating crops like corn, soybean, cotton, fruits, and nuts in India. Rahul Gandhi accused Prime Minister Narendra Modi of being 'anti-farmer' and 'selling' the country through this agreement, vowing to fight for farmers' interests despite potential legal or parliamentary actions against him. The India — Indian National Congress is positioning agricultural concerns at the center of its political strategy, aiming to mobilize public support against the deal.
